当我试图使用sudo作为管理员运行mvn命令时,我在mac中遇到了这个问题,我得到了以下错误:
The operation couldn’t be completed. Unable to locate a Java Runtime.
Please visit http://www.java.com for information on installing Java.
但是,当我执行命令时,不需要做它的工作。在终端中使用java时也会发生同样的情况,使用像java -version这样简单的东西--在使用sudo时返回相同的错误。但不用sudo就能工作得很好。
有人能给我个机会或者解释一下为
我正在使用spring-integration 2.1和SFTP出站通道适配器组件来将文件传输到远程位置。断断续续地,我得到了以下异常:
Error handling message for file <file_name> _org.springframework.integration.MessageDeliveryException: Error handling message for file <file_name>
... stack was trimmed to be contained in a single post...
Caused by: or
我正在使用主机名从客户端连接到服务器,如下所示:
HttpPost post = new HttpPost(serverUrl);
post.setEntity(new StringEntity(jsonRequestString, ContentType.APPLICATION_JSON));
HttpResponse response = httpClient.execute(post);
int ret = response.getStatusLine().getStatusCode();
我正在使用org.apache.http.*软件包。现在,服务器位
我可以在我的HTML中包含外部URL并获得HTML中的内容吗,就像jstl一样,这样我们就不必有连接问题或使用java代码。如果我们使用jstl,它必须打开套接字并进行处理,而不是直接包括外部url,目前我正在实现这种方式。
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<%@ taglib uri="http://java.sun.com/jstl/core" prefix="c" %>
<%@page
language=
我想有一个地图与关键映射到一个相当大的对象。由于映射将用作缓存,因此我希望通过软链接(java.lang.ref.SoftReference)引用值/条目,以便在纯内存中清除它。但在这种情况下,我需要有自己的computeIfAbsent()方法实现。 我可以通过以下方式实现它: Map<Integer, SoftReference<T>> myMap = new HashMap<>();
public T get(Integer key) {
SoftReference<T> value = myMap.get(key);